Duties

Help
  • Provides technical direction, planning, and policy leadership to formulate, create and implement new agency policy, competency management processes, and surveillance operations processes.
  • Provides leadership in the preparation of project milestones.
  • Provides a high level of technical expertise in systems analysis, operations research, project planning and controls, statistics, mathematics, and modeling methods.
  • Prepares comprehensive technical reports of completed studies, assuring adequate correlation of data, integration of all pertinent considerations, and substantiation of conclusions.
  • Participates in the preparation and presentation of project briefings.

Qualifications

To qualify for an Operations Research Analyst, your resume and supporting documentation must support:

A. Basic Education Requirement: A Bachelor's Degree or higher in operations research; OR at least 24 semester hours in a combination of operations research, mathematics, probability, statistics, mathematical logic, science, or subject- matter courses requiring substantial competence in college-level mathematics or statistics. At least 3 of the 24 semester hours must have been in calculus.

NOTE: Courses acceptable for qualifying for operations research positions may have been taken in departments other than Operations Research, e.g., Engineering (usually Industrial Engineering), Science, Economics, Mathematics, Statistics, or Management Science. The following are illustrative of acceptable courses: optimization; mathematical modeling; queueing theory; engineering; physics (except descriptive or survey courses); econometrics; psychometrics; biometrics; experimental psychology; physical chemistry; industrial process analysis; managerial economics; computer science; measurement for management; mathematical models in social phenomena; and courses that involved application of operations research techniques and methodologies to problems of management, marketing, systems design, and other specialized fields; or other comparable quantitative analysis courses for which college- level mathematics or statistics is a prerequisite.
